Order rules workflow features allow you to set automatic actions whenever a Sales or Purchase Order matches specific conditions.
These conditions vary depending on the sales and fulfillment channel supported features.

As a guideline, conditions can relate to, but are not limited to, the following fields and functions:
- Order references
- Sources
- Ship-to address information
- Total value
- Sales Channel and Warehouse
- Carrier and Service Levels
- Tags
- SKU information
- Product variants
- Warehouse or Source
- Status and Expected Delivery Days
- Stock values
Creating an order rule consist of the following phases:
- Creating the order rule
- Configuring the order rule
A. CREATING THE ORDER RULE
To create an order rule:
1. Select the desired account from the header switcher.
2. Click Order Rules from the left menu under the Sales or Purchases section, depending on the desired order rule type.
3. Press Create.
4. Enter the order rule's description and trigger:
- Description: A brief description of the order rule (e.g., "Add Lithium Battery Sticker"). Make sure to enter a succinct but comprehensive description to make the order rule easy to find and maintain.
- Trigger: Select the action that will trigger the order rule workflow:
- Create Sales/Purchase Order API: Triggers the workflow when the Sales/Purchase Order in techOMS is created, either by using the user interface or when it is received via API.
- Allocate & Fulfill Sales Order UI: Triggers the workflow when the order is manually Allocated and Fulfilled from the techOMS user interface. This option is available for Sales Order Rules only.
- Run Workflow UI: Triggers the workflow only when the user does so from the techOMS user interface. This option is available for Purchase Order Rules only.
5. Press Save to create the order rule.
B. CONFIGURING THE ORDER RULE
Once you have created the order rule, you need to configure the steps and actions it will perform.
To configure these steps and actions, locate the newly created order rule and follow the instructions in How to Edit Sales/Purchase Order Rules [Step-by-step guide].
